Abstract
The study revealed a marked qualitative and quantitative differences i n the pattern of expression of three stress-related cucumber (Cucumis sativus L., cv. Laura) isoperoxidases. Activity staining, as well as t he protein gel blot (Western blotting) confirmed that the proteins stu died are differentially expressed in both male and female sepals, in m ale but not in female pedicels and in pistil. By using antibodies spec ific to three stress-related peroxidases, one serologically related pi stil-specific anionic peroxidase was detected. This specific band had never been observed in other newer organs. Differential appearance of the stress-related peroxidase isoenzymes in both male and female flowe rs demonstrates that these proteins are developmentally regulated, sho wing an organ-specific expression.
